Transaction 70d0db6ee462f611f689bde375edd258b4971002c86cb0c4abde2cee13c416a3
1 Input
1 Output
-
70d0db6ee462f611f689bde375edd258b4971002c86cb0c4abde2cee13c416a3:0
- value
- 15622
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3d639dd587c54c70593ba95c32471d017a8f5fd OP_EQUAL
- address
- 3NThwmuSsfUSfQYjaUBcLfJE7edpGdxNN3